Press Release: GP Conference .. Pension Crisis Could Be Solved By Government Death From Waste Policy.

Incineration seriously damages public health, Leading Toxicologist claims.

The governments policy of incinerating radioactive and toxic wastes is
resulting in the deaths of literally tens of thousands every year, a
government recognised toxicologist and incinerator expert revealed.

Speaking at the Green Party conference in Weston Super-Mare, Dr Van Steenis
and Michael Ryan, a civil engineer who lost both his mother and son from
leukaemia and a daughter to cot death.

They have spent many years examining the effects of incineration on the
population,

Mr Ryan, presented official government data on public health, for incinerators around the country, together with a detailed examination of the existing Colnbrook 1 Ton Per Hr Clinical Radioactive and Hazardous waste Incinerator.

The site beside Heathrow Airport is where Grundon’s plan to build 2 huge incinerators in the near future, One of which will be the second largest in Europe, the largest is destined to live in Kent. The data showed alarming and continuing rise in mortality, cancers, birth Defects, heart and lung disease and pregnancy failures in the vicinity of incinerator sites.

(see data for Hillingdon below.)

Dr VS said that studies of the St Nikalas incinerator in
Belgium over a twenty year period have proved that life expectancy of people living
in a twenty mile radius of an incineration plant decreases by an average
of twelve years. This research is corroborated by other world-wide studies.

In Britain these incinerators, sited by government policy in already
Polluted, densely populated areas. The evidence to say they pose a direct threat to the public health is overwhelming, particularly to the health of the young and unborn.

Children are particularly vulnerable to the effects of particulates, very small toxic particles, the smaller the particle the more deadly they are. The world health organisations say particulates are one of the modern worlds biggest health threats.
